UBSFTC provides trust and investment management services to retirement plans through financial advisers, from financial services company UBS Americas Inc. Effective today, New Jersey-based UBSFTC operates as Wilmington Trust Fiduciary Services Company, which is part of Wilmington Trust’s Corporate Client Services (CCS) business, according to a press release.
This is the second acquisition Wilmington Trust has made this year in CCS’ retirement and institutional services business. In April, the company acquired Arizona-based AST Capital Trust Company (AST), which Wilmington said doubled the capacity of its retirement business (see Wilmington Trust Expands with Acquisition of AST Capital Trust).
As a result of both acquisitions, Wilmington Trust provides directed trustee, custodial, trading, and paying agent services to more than 3,800 retirement and employee benefit plans with more than $47 billion in assets under administration, according to the release.
